1. Flight Performance and Features:
* Flight Time and Range: How long can it fly on a single charge, and what is its maximum control range?
* GPS and Navigation: Does it have GPS for precise positioning and automated features like "return to home"?
* Obstacle Avoidance: Does it have sensors to detect obstacles and avoid collisions?
* Flight Modes: What different flight modes are available, such as sport mode, follow me mode, or point of interest mode?
* Wind Resistance: How well does it handle strong winds?
* Stability and Control: How smooth and responsive is the drone in flight?
2. Camera and Video Features:
* Camera Resolution and Sensor Size: What is the image resolution and video recording resolution?
* Image Stabilization: Does it have electronic image stabilization (EIS) or mechanical gimbal stabilization for smooth footage?
* Field of View: What is the lens's field of view (wide, standard, or telephoto)?
* Features: Does it offer features like HDR, slow-motion video, or time-lapse photography?
* Storage and Connectivity: How much onboard storage is available, and what types of SD cards does it support? How does it connect to your smartphone or tablet?
3. Design and Build Quality:
* Material and Durability: What is the drone constructed from, and is it built to withstand crashes?
* Folding Design: Does it fold for easy portability?
* Weight and Size: How large and heavy is the drone?
* Propeller Design: Are the propellers efficient and quiet?
4. Battery and Charging:
* Battery Capacity: How long does the battery last, and how long does it take to charge?
* Spare Batteries: Are spare batteries available?
* Charging System: Does it use a proprietary charging system or standard USB charging?
5. Software and Apps:
* App Functionality: What features and controls are available in the companion app?
* Ease of Use: Is the app user-friendly and intuitive?
* Flight Planning and Editing: Does the app allow for flight path planning or video editing?
6. Price and Value:
* Cost: How does the price compare to competitors?
* Value for Money: Does the drone offer good features and performance for the price?
7. User Experience:
* Setup and Use: How easy is it to assemble, calibrate, and control the drone?
* Learning Curve: How quickly can a beginner learn to use the drone effectively?
* Customer Support: Is customer support available and responsive?
